Overview
FIRSTFRUITS GOSPEL FOUNDATION was established in 2019 as a private Christian family grant-making foundation. In the financial year ending June 2024, the charity had a total income of £1,793,580 and distributed £449,451 in charitable grants. The foundation's mission is to share the love and compassion of Jesus Christ by partnering financially with charities, organisations, and individuals that help vulnerable people in desperate situations. The foundation is guided by the biblical principle of “firstfruits” from Nehemiah 10:13, emphasizing bringing the first of their resources to support God's work. They prioritize organizations where support will make a tangible difference and direct most funding to front-line services rather than bureaucratic overhead.
Funding Priorities
Grant Programs
- Regular Grants: £250 - £5,000 (no formal application form required, rolling basis)
- One-off Grants: Flexible amounts for specific needs
- Seed Funding: Supporting new initiatives
- Strategic Support: Larger funding available for established relationships with demonstrated clear benefits
Priority Areas
- Relief of poverty and financial hardship
- Support for those facing ill health
- Assistance for elderly and vulnerable people
- Crisis intervention and emergency support
- Advancement of the evangelical Christian faith
- Support for Christian charities and organisations
- Healthcare initiatives
- Cultural and arts programs
- Educational courses
Geographic Focus
The foundation has considerable flexibility but aims primarily to support charities, organisations, and individuals local to Yorkshire, while remaining open to nationwide charities.

Governance and Leadership
Trustees
- Simon David Pillar (Chair) - Appointed June 2019
- Rebecca Sylvia Charlotte Pillar - Appointed June 2019
- John Stephen Riches - Appointed June 2019
All three trustees are British nationals. No trustees receive remuneration, payments, or benefits from the charity, ensuring all resources are directed toward grant-making activities. The foundation employs 2 staff members to support its operations.
Application Process and Timeline
How to Apply
The foundation operates an accessible, informal application process:
- No formal application form required
- Submit applications via email to applications@first-fruits.org.uk or through their online form
- Include in your application:
- Details of your work or project
- Who will be supported and how
- Funding amount requested
- Expected outcomes and impact
Decision Timeline
- Applications are considered individually
- Response provided within 6 weeks of application submission
- Rolling basis assessment (no fixed deadlines)

Application Success Factors
Key Considerations
Based on the foundation's stated values and priorities, successful applications should demonstrate:
- Tangible Impact: Clear evidence that funding will make a measurable difference to beneficiaries
- Efficient Resource Use: Organizations that direct the majority of resources to front-line services rather than overhead
- Crisis Support: Projects addressing immediate needs for people in vulnerable situations
- Yorkshire Connection: Priority given to local organizations and causes (though not exclusively)
- Christian Alignment: For faith-based organizations, alignment with evangelical Christian values
- Clear Outcomes: Well-defined expected results and how success will be measured
Application Approach
The foundation values:
- Direct, honest communication about needs and challenges
- Specific funding requests with clear justification
- Evidence of how previous support (if applicable) was used effectively
- Demonstration of need, particularly for poverty relief and health-related issues
Funding Range Strategy
- Smaller grants (£250-£5,000) are standard and accessible
- Larger grants require established relationships and proven track record
- Consider building a relationship through smaller grants before requesting larger amounts
Key Takeaways for Grant Writers
- Simple Application Process: No complex forms—email or online submission makes this an accessible funder for organizations of all sizes
- Quick Turnaround: Six-week response time is faster than many funders, helpful for time-sensitive projects
- Yorkshire Focus: Local organizations in Yorkshire should emphasize their regional impact and community connections
- Christian Foundation: While they support various causes, alignment with Christian values and support for Christian organizations is central to their mission
- Efficiency Matters: Demonstrate that funding goes directly to beneficiaries rather than administrative costs
- Relationship Building: Larger grants are more likely with established relationships—consider starting small
- Flexibility: Open to individuals, charities, and organizations across various sectors including healthcare, culture, education, and poverty relief
